Job Description:

The AI Frameworks team at Microsoft develops AI software that enables running AI models everywhere, from world’s fastest AI supercomputers, to servers, desktops, mobile phones, IoT devices, and internet browsers. We collaborate with our hardware teams and partners to build the software stacks for novel AI accelerators. We work closely with ML researchers and developers to optimize and scale out model training and inference. The team operates at the intersection of AI algorithmic innovation, purpose-built AI hardware, systems, and software. We are a cross-discipline team of highly capable and motivated people with a collaborative and inclusive culture. As a Software Engineer, you will be responsible for designing, implementing, and ensuring quality of AI chip simulator, related tools and its integration and timely delivery as part of SDK. This is a technical role that demands hands-on experience in all phases of software development: concept, software design, implementation, and verification. An entrepreneurial mindset and quick adaptation to innovative ideas and concepts are critical for fast ramp-up and contribution to a large-scale project. Knowledge of computer architecture and/or embedded programming is essential for successful candidates.
